How many backlinks you need depends on what you're trying to achieve. The more you want to achieve, the more backlinks you will need. You can potentially rank your business's website with literally just a few backlinks, but that would be for low competition keywords with low search volumes, meaning you would get few visitorsto your site.
Any general nu,ber of backlinks given as a target could be arqued against, as it will vary very much from business to business. However, a small business should be looking to get 50 quality backlinks to get their SEO campaign off to a good start. With 50 quality backlinks it would be reasonable to expect first page ramkings for 5 or so keywords of average competitiveness.

A "backlink" is created when an external website links to yours. This why some people refer to them as "external backlinks".Link building is an art. It's almost always the most challenging part of an SEO's job, but also the one most critical to success. Link building requires creativity, hustle, and often, a budget. No two link building campaigns are the same, and the way you choose to build links depends as much upon your website as it does your personality.

In essence, backlinks to your website are a signal to search engines that others vouch for your content. If many sites link to the same webpage or website, search engines can infer that content is worth linking to, and therefore also worth surfacing on a SERP.

Use links that are natural for the reader, don't overdo it unnecessarily. One of the benefits of internal linking is that it improves user engagement on your site. When a user sees an informative link that truly matches the context of the content, they are likely to click on that link. There is no specific number just think about improving user engagement.
